Add 30/56 and 32/63
30/56 + 32/63 is 263/252.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 56 and 63 is 504
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 504 - For the 1st fraction, since 56 × 9 = 504,
30/56 = 30 × 9/56 × 9 = 270/504 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 63 × 8 = 504,
32/63 = 32 × 8/63 × 8 = 256/504 - Add the two like fractions:
270/504 + 256/504 = 270 + 256/504 = 526/504 - 526/504 simplified gives 263/252
- So, 30/56 + 32/63 = 263/252
